EDITORS COMMENTS
This print showcases a remarkable Hand-carved Cabinet, crafted by the talented artist Vera Van Voris in 1937. The intricate details and exquisite craftsmanship of this piece truly embody the essence of American art during the 20th century. The cabinet, adorned with vibrant floral motifs, stands as a testament to Van Voris' mastery in carpentry and carving techniques. Its multi-colored design reflects the rich cultural heritage and artistic expression prevalent in America at that time. Within this stunning artifact lies a fusion of religious symbolism and functional utility. A crucifix adorns one side, symbolizing Christianity's profound influence on American culture, while inside rests an array of compartments for storing clothes or linen. Van Voris utilized watercolor colored pencil gouache and graphite on paper to bring her vision to life, resulting in a visually striking representation captured within this photo print. Preserved within the National Gallery of Art Washington's collection, this hand-carved cabinet serves as an important index of American design history. It embodies both the skillful craftsmanship of its creator and the spirit of creativity that defined America during the thirties.
